Miles Davis – Live At The Fillmore East (March 7, 1970): It's About That Time
All tracks previously unreleased.
Recorded March 7, 1970, at the Fillmore East, NYC.


Standard slim double jewel case held in a plastic o-card.

Initially released as part of the "Miles 75 Anniversary" series. It included a logo on a silver hype sticker on the outer shrink and also the same logo printed on the CD below the Sony Legacy logo.

Label: Columbia – C2K 85191, Legacy – C2K 85191
Series: Columbia Jazz, Miles 75 Anniversary
Format: 2 x CD, Album, O-Card
Country: US
Released: Aug 21, 2001
Genre: Jazz
Style: Fusion
